200-IMLA GPS ANTENNA, INTEGRATED MULTIPATH LIMITING
Specifications
Performance Characteristics:
Type: Multipath Limiting Antenna Vertical Dipole Array
Azimuth Gain Variation from +3° to + 35° in Elevation: Omni-Directional, with Maximum Azimuth Gain Variation of < or = to ± 1.5 dB with no Phase Reversals in Azimuth or Elevation
Frequency Range: 1575.42 MHz ± 20 MHz
Array: 14 Element Cylindrical Dipole Array (57.5" tall)
Polarization: Vertically Polarized
Gain, main beam: > or = to 7 dBi, In Main Vertical Plane
Minimum Gain Between +5° to + 35° in Elevation: > or = to 0 dBi
Direction of Maximum Gain in Elevation: 12° ± 1° above Horizon
Slope (Vicinity of horizon): ˜ 3 dB/Deg
Power Handling Capability: Up To At Least 35 W Peak RF Power At 20% Duty Cycle
Impedance: 50 ohm nominal
VSWR: Not greater than 1.5:1 Measured At End Of Low Loss Cable Not Exceeding 5 Feet In Length.
Desired-To-Undesired Ratio Between 0° and 40° In Elevation: 95% Of Elevation Measurements Must Meet The Desired-To-Undesired Signal Performance Requirement Shown In Figure 3-1.
Phase Center Stability Between +3° and +35° in Elevation Angle: The Electrical Phase Center of the Antenna Must Not Vary More than ± 2 cm When Subjected to the Environmental Conditions of FAA-G-2100 Environment III. See Figure 3-2 for Phase Variation as Function of Vertical Angle.
Gain Variation from +3° to -3° in elevation at any azimuth angle: Monotonically Decreasing With No More than 3 dB Ripple.
Radome Coverage and Weather proofing: Entire Antenna weather proofed and Covered by Radome. Removal/replacement of subassemblies possible without sealing compounds.
ADA Adapter Height, Weight and Size, (other): dBs 200-ADA. Adapter for Obstruction Lights, Lightning Protection, Air Terminals and Physical Mount for dBs 200A-HZA antenna. Height 33” x Width 35" x Depth 6” x 18 Lbs. Obstruction Light Connector is MS-3112E8-3P.
High Zenith Antenna RF Cable: RG-142 B/U RF Cable Run Between HZA and Bottom of MLA Provided. HZA End of Cable has SMA Plug, MLA Bottom End of Cable Has Type N Jack. Maximum Loss of Cable Run < or = to 2.5 dB.
MLA Height, Weight & Size: 77" long x 7" Dia. x 42 lbs.
Shipping Container Height, Weight and Size: Complete Shipping Container Height 31.5” x 30.5” Wide x 130” Long x 245 lbs Weight. (excluding IMLA). Note: Pipe Adapter not Connected to IMLA during Shipment. Complete Shipping Weight 380 lbs (IMLA and Container).
Antenna Mounting: 6 each 3/8"-16 bolts on 6.0" Bolt Circle which mount MLA to Pipe Adapter. Pipe Adapter Mounts to 4” O.D. Vertical Mounting Pipe. Vertical Mounting Pipe Provided by Customer. 8 bolts for plumbing/leveling.
Wind loading: Withstands without damage 100 mile per hour gusts.
RF Feed Connectors: One Type N Jack RF port for MLA connection and one Type N Jack RF port for MLHZA connection at base of MLA antenna. Connectors located at each plate/clamp.
MLA Low Noise Amplifier: Located within Pipe Adapter. Can be Bypassed for Pseudolite Transmission. 25 dB Gain, Noise Figure < or = to 1.5 dB, 50 dB Out-of-Band Rejection, +7 to +32 VDC Input
FAA Environmental Requirements: FAA-G-2100F, Environment III
